The Folded Sandstone Basin
C rossing the historic Tradouw Pass into the ancient, semi-arid Little Karoo. Mornings begin with slow botanical walks through rare succulence, seeking out San rock art galleries dating back over three millennia etched into private mountain overhangs.

The Ochre Dunes of Tswalu
A direct Pilatus PC-12 private tarmac touchdown inside South Africa’s largest private game reserve. Days are entirely unscripted—tracking habituated meerkat colonies at sunrise, horseback safaris over red sand dunes, and twilight sweeps for nocturnal aardvarks.
